Something else: With slime current from cvs multiple repls in the same image don't seem to work. If i start swank with swank:create-server :port 6666 :dont-close t, and then connect with slime-connect only the first connection creates a repl. Subsequent ones do nothing (this used to work in the past). Also, doing slime-open-listener and including slime-mrepl creates a new listener but 1) slime-presentations do not work in the listener 2) I can only create at most 1 new listener 3) If i press enter on the listener i get: end of file on #<SB-IMPL::STRING-INPUT-STREAM {11A83009}> [Condition of type END-OF-FILE] Restarts: 0: [TERMINATE-THREAD] Terminate this thread (#<THREAD "swank- listener-thread" RUNNING {11A75EA9}>
